Taking Close up Pictures
The camera has two close-up picture modes to allow you to take pictures at close range. The
Macro Mode (
) should be used for object located at about 20 c.m., while the Portrait Mode
(
) should be used for object located from 60 c.m. to 100 c.m..
To take close-up pictures:
1. Press MODE button to switch to Picture Record Mode.
2. Shift the macro switch to Macro (
) or Portrait ( ) positions. In Macro Mode, the
macro icon (
) will appear on the LCD monitor.
3. Press the shutter button
to take the picture.
Note
Remember to turn the macro switch back to
Normal (
) when you are not taking
close-up pictures.
Using Digital Zoom
The digital zoom magnifies images up to eight times when recording movies or taking pictures.
1. To zoom in/out, press the Tele/Wide button.
2. The digital zoom can be set from 1x to 8x and the magnification ratio is shown on the
LCD monitor.
